Kia cars have an immobiliser. It is designed to stop theft. The key has an electronic transponder that sends an encrypted signal to the vehicle, which will only be able to start if the right key is used.

Kia UK has released a pouch to deter thieves from scurrying around in the dark near your home It acts as a minuscule Faraday cage to block the signal coming from the key.

Most Kia models include a remote/fob or smart key. They contain an transponder chip that needs to be programmed in order to start the car. The chips that are used in these keys vary from 1995 to 2000. They are referred to as Texas crypto 4D type 13 or T5.

You may also require an additional key fob battery. The most popular battery for Kia remotes is the CR2032 lithium battery. You can purchase them at most automotive stores. Be sure to remove the old battery and put it in a secure place.

Kia's smart keys include an integrated radio transmitter which can lock and unlock your vehicle from a distance. They also allow you to remotely open the trunk. In addition, they disable the ignition if you press the handle on the driver's side of the door. However this feature isn't accessible on all vehicles.

Burgh Locksmiths can supply replacement Kia keys for almost all models of cars, from 1998 and onwards. Keys contain microchips that communicate with the security system to confirm the key is authentic and has been programmed to the vehicle you are using it for. The first chip in Kia vehicles was a Texas Crypto 4D type 13 but later cars have chips with rolling code.
